RIP Jeroen Brouwers (1940 – 2022)
Jeroen Brouwers was a Dutch writer known for such novels as Sunken Red (1981).
Sunken Red (1981) is the story of the author locked up with his mother in a Japanese concentration camp.
Published after the death of his mother, it is a reflection of the coping process of his years in these Japanese internment camps.
Guy Cassiers directed a play based on the English translation of the book. It starred Dirk Roofthooft.
RIP Enrique Metinides (1934 – 2022)
Enrique Metinides was a Mexican photojournalist working for the nota roja tabloids, producing pictures of murders and accidents such as “Adela Legarreta Rivas is struck by a white Datsun on Avenida Chapultepec, Mexico City, 29 April 1979” (1979).
